Gloria Jean M. Kramer age 83 of Long Prairie, Minnesota passed away peacefully on Saturday, February 8, 2025 at the Alomere Health in Alexandria, Minnesota.
A memorial service will be held at 10 a.m. Monday, February 24 at the Patton-Schad Funeral Home in Sauk Centre with Steven Wielenberg officiating. Inurnment will be at St. Paul’s Cemetery in Sauk Centre.
Visitation will be from 9 to 10 a.m. Monday at the funeral home in Sauk Centre.
Gloria Jean Maxine Crabbe was born November 26, 1941 in Fargo, North Dakota to Nelson and Doris (Paseka) Crabbe. In August of 1990, she married Frank Kramer at their home in Long Prairie. She worked at Electrolux in St. Cloud for many years until her retirement.
Gloria enjoyed going to garage sales, eating chicken at Diamond Point on Wednesday nights, gardening, and going for walks.
Gloria was a member of St. Paul’s Catholic Church in Sauk Centre and the VFW Auxiliary.
Survivors include children, Tammy Lynn (Dennis) Fischer of Florida, Pollyanne (James) Lombardi of Long Prairie, Gary Kramer (Karen) of Long Prairie, Scott (Tammy) Kramer of Waite Park, and Kimberly (Andrew) Sandy of Eagle Bend; many grandchildren and great-grandchildren; sisters and brother, Connie (Ray) Steiger, Mary Jo (Gene) Grussing, Mimi (Bob) Weijland, and Terry Palmer; and nephew, Ray (Vickie) Bingham.
Gloria was preceded in death by her parents; husband, Frank “Frankie” Kramer; son, Burton “Buck” Hittle, Jr.; infant son, Wade; infant daughter, Roxanne; sisters, Dixie (Ray Sr.) Bingham and Georgia Heupel; and brothers, Donny and Larry Crabbe.
